Re: diet. My understanding is that for weight loss, diet is more important than exercise. Both together, of course, but diet is key. If you're trying to kick a regular chocolate habit (I love chocolate too. Who doesn't?), you might want to try very dark chocolate, and just a little every day or every other day. It has much less sugar and for me, doesn't spike a craving like regular sweet chocolate does. Cutting out sugar completely might be better and faster, but you're trying to do a lot of stuff at once, and there's usually only so much willpower to go around :-)
